Kate Middleton, row record for the wedding dress on display at Buckingham Palace

Who is planning to go to London and loves the romantic tale of Prince William and Kate until 3 October for 17.50 pounds (less than 20 euro) puòvisitare Buckingham Palace and the annual summer exhibition on its inhabitants. Strong piece of exposure (150,000 people already visited) the beautiful Kate's wedding dress with veil, earrings, lace shoes and the valuable Cartier tiara, lent by the Queen. 
 The dress, designed by Sarah Burton, Creative Director of Alexander McQueen, who took the reins of the death of the designer brands in 2010, is made of satin and silk gazar and embellished with lace applications of different types.

The lace is the work of Embroiderers from the Royal School of Needlework in London, located at Hampton Court Palace, held in the months of work unaware of the destination of the embroidery. Changing needle every 3 hours and washing their hands every half-hour (or so they say), the Embroiderers have followed a technique invented in Ireland in the early 1800s, called Carrickmacross, which incorporates decorative symbols in each of the 4 countries of the United Kingdom: the rose (England), thistle (Scotland), Daffodil (Wales) and clover (Northern Ireland), each individually applied to silk tulle. In addition to wedding dress signed Sarah Burton, chocoholics can admire the Baroque and candid wedding cake created by Fiona Cairns.
